La seguridad digital y el SEO, tradicionalmente vistos como disciplinas separadas, están convergiendo a un ritmo acelerado. En la era actual, donde las amenazas cibernéticas son cada vez más sofisticadas y las expectativas de los usuarios en cuanto a privacidad y confiabilidad son máximas, una estrategia de SEO que ignore la seguridad es, en esencia, una estrategia con un punto ciego crítico. Una auditoría técnica de seguridad orientada al SEO no es un lujo, sino una necesidad imperativa para cualquier negocio digital que busque no solo alcanzar, sino sostener un posicionamiento sólido y una visibilidad orgánica inexpugnable.
Más Allá del HTTPS: Comprendiendo el Ecosistema de Amenazas SEO
Si bien la migración a HTTPS fue un hito fundamental, elevando la encriptación de datos como un factor de clasificación, la seguridad SEO va mucho más allá. Un sitio web puede tener un certificado SSL impecable y, aun así, ser vulnerable a una miríada de ataques que impactarán directamente su capacidad de ser rastreado, indexado y clasificado por los motores de búsqueda. Desde inyecciones de código malicioso que alteran el contenido visible o redirigen a los usuarios, hasta ataques de denegación de servicio (DDoS) que paralizan la accesibilidad, cada vulnerabilidad de seguridad es una puerta abierta a la degradación del rendimiento SEO.
Los motores de búsqueda, encabezados por Google, son cada vez más sofisticados en la detección de sitios comprometidos. Un sitio clasificado como "peligroso" o "infectado" no solo pierde la confianza del usuario, sino que es penalizado severamente en los rankings, llegando incluso a ser desindexado. Recuperarse de una de estas penalizaciones puede ser un proceso largo y costoso, subrayando la importancia de una postura proactiva.
Vulnerabilidades de Seguridad Comunes y su Impacto Directo en el SEO
- Malware e Inyecciones de Contenido: Los atacantes pueden inyectar spam farmacéutico, enlaces ocultos o contenido de "puerta trasera" (doorway pages) en tu sitio. Esto no solo degrada la experiencia del usuario, sino que confunde a los rastreadores de Google, que pueden interpretar tu sitio como un generador de spam, resultando en penalizaciones manuales o algorítmicas. El "cloaking" malicioso, donde se muestra contenido diferente a los bots y a los usuarios, es otra táctica común que lleva a la desindexación.
- Ataques de Denegación de Servicio Distribuido (DDoS): Un ataque DDoS sobrecarga tu servidor, haciendo que tu sitio sea inaccesible. Durante estos períodos, los rastreadores de los motores de búsqueda no pueden acceder a tu contenido, lo que lleva a errores de rastreo masivos, agotamiento del "crawl budget" y, en última instancia, una caída en los rankings debido a la percepción de inestabilidad o inaccesibilidad del sitio.
- Cross-Site Scripting (XSS) y SQL Injection: Estas vulnerabilidades permiten a los atacantes inyectar scripts maliciosos en tu sitio o manipular tu base de datos. Un script XSS podría, por ejemplo, redirigir a los usuarios a sitios maliciosos o robar cookies, afectando la reputación de tu sitio. Una SQL Injection podría alterar datos clave, incluyendo metadatos, contenido o incluso configuraciones de redirección, impactando directamente la indexación y la relevancia del contenido.
- Plugins y Temas Inseguros: En plataformas como WordPress, los plugins y temas de terceros son una fuente común de vulnerabilidades. Un plugin desactualizado o mal codificado puede contener "backdoors" que permiten el acceso no autorizado, la inyección de código o la creación de nuevas páginas spam que canibalizan tu SEO legítimo o difunden contenido dañino.
- Configuraciones de Servidor Deficientes: Servidores mal configurados pueden exponer directorios sensibles, archivos de configuración o APIs sin la debida protección. Esto facilita el acceso a datos críticos o la manipulación del sitio, desde la alteración del archivo
robots.txthasta la inserción de redirecciones no autorizadas que desvían el tráfico orgánico. - Fallas en la Autenticación y Autorización: Credenciales débiles, sistemas de autenticación deficientes o una mala gestión de permisos pueden otorgar acceso a atacantes a paneles de control del CMS, Google Search Console, Google Analytics o incluso herramientas SEO. Esto les permitiría manipular configuraciones, inyectar código, eliminar contenido o sabotear informes, distorsionando por completo la estrategia SEO.
El Proceso de Auditoría Técnica de Seguridad SEO: Una Metodología Profunda
Una auditoría de seguridad SEO debe ser un proceso metódico que abarque múltiples capas de tu infraestructura digital. Aquí se detallan los pasos clave:
- Análisis de Vulnerabilidades (Vulnerability Scanning): Utiliza herramientas automatizadas (como Acunetix, Burp Suite, OWASP ZAP) para identificar vulnerabilidades conocidas en la aplicación web, el servidor y las dependencias (plugins, librerías).
- Revisión del Código Fuente: Especialmente relevante para sitios con desarrollo personalizado. Un examen manual o con herramientas SAST (Static Application Security Testing) puede revelar vulnerabilidades lógicas o errores de codificación que podrían ser explotados.
- Evaluación de la Configuración del Servidor: Verifica el endurecimiento del servidor, la correcta configuración de firewalls (WAF), permisos de archivos y directorios, y la implementación de cabeceras de seguridad como HSTS, CSP y X-Content-Type-Options. Asegúrate de que no haya puertos abiertos innecesarios o servicios expuestos.
- Inspección de Plugins y Temas: Revisa la lista completa de plugins y temas instalados. Verifica que estén actualizados, que provengan de fuentes confiables y que no tengan vulnerabilidades conocidas. Elimina los no utilizados.
- Auditoría de Bases de Datos: Asegúrate de que la base de datos esté configurada de forma segura, con credenciales robustas y sin exposición de datos sensibles. Revisa si hay indicios de inyecciones SQL previas o tablas sospechosas.
- Análisis de Archivos de Log: Examina los logs del servidor y del CMS en busca de patrones de acceso sospechosos, intentos de inyección, escaneos de vulnerabilidades o picos de tráfico anómalos que puedan indicar un ataque DDoS.
- Revisión de Google Search Console: Busca mensajes de seguridad, advertencias de malware, picos inusuales en errores de rastreo o problemas de indexación que Google haya detectado.
- Pruebas de Penetración (Penetration Testing): Si los recursos lo permiten, una prueba de penetración ética puede simular un ataque real para descubrir vulnerabilidades que no fueron detectadas por métodos automatizados.
Mitigación y Monitoreo Continuo: La Defensa Post-Auditoría
Una vez identificadas las vulnerabilidades, la fase de mitigación es crítica. Esto incluye:
- Parches y Actualizaciones: Mantén todo el software (CMS, plugins, temas, servidor) actualizado.
- Implementación de WAF (Web Application Firewall): Protege contra ataques comunes como XSS y SQL Injection.
- Hardening del Servidor: Restringe permisos, desactiva servicios innecesarios y configura cabeceras de seguridad.
- Backups Regulares: Ten copias de seguridad consistentes y verificadas para una rápida recuperación.
- Seguridad de Contraseñas: Fuerza contraseñas robustas y autenticación multifactor.
- Monitoreo Constante: Utiliza herramientas de monitoreo de integridad de archivos (FIM), detección de malware y monitoreo de logs para detectar anomalías en tiempo real.
La seguridad no es un evento único, sino un proceso continuo. La implementación de una auditoría técnica de seguridad SEO como parte integral de tu estrategia digital no solo protege tu activo más valioso en línea, sino que también refuerza la confianza de los motores de búsqueda y, fundamentalmente, de tus usuarios. Al blindar tu infraestructura digital, estás sentando las bases para una visibilidad orgánica duradera y exitosa, invulnerable a las vicisitudes del ciberespacio.